DEEN FAMILY’S HUMBLE BEGINNINGS

The Deen family has made a good name in the culinary world but they did not become successful overnight.

Advertisement

Paula first started a lunch delivery service called “The Bag Lady” with her sons. Together, the family delivered bag lunches around town to business people in their workplaces.

As the business grew, the business expanded into a full-fledged restaurant in 1991. “The Bag Lady” was named “The Lady In The Best Western Hotel” on Savannah.

The success of “The Bag Lady” ultimately enabled the Deens to open “The Lady & Sons” on January 8, 1996.
